mudler / luet

:package: :whale: 0-dependency Container-based Package Manager using SAT solver and QLearning
https://luet.io
GNU General Public License v3.0
254 stars 24 forks source link

Package keeps being rebuilt each time the collection changes #287

Open msdobrescu opened 2 years ago

msdobrescu commented 2 years ago

Luet version:

0.22.7-gbff45b9bd953b46dda8498495d5d6e1b4575fe8c 2022-01-09

CPU architecture, OS, and Version:

GH's

Describe the bug

This build set https://github.com/mocaccinoOS/community-repository/actions/runs/1766146717 should not have rebuilt apps-dvd+rw-tools-7.1-r4. Neither next build, https://github.com/mocaccinoOS/community-repository/actions/runs/1766230586. And so on.

To Reproduce

Commit a change to the community repository collection.

Expected behavior

The packages must be built once per version change.

Logs

Additional context

@mudler diagnosis of the cause is the presence of the "+" character in the package name.